Understanding Common Issues with the Boss Snow Plow Wiring Harness

Many discussions about the boss snow plow wiring harness center around troubleshooting common malfunctions that can arise. A frequent topic is corrosion within the connectors, especially in regions with heavy salt usage. This corrosion can impede electrical conductivity, leading to intermittent or complete failure of the plow’s functions. Another commonly discussed problem is physical damage to the wiring itself, often caused by abrasion, pinching, or exposure to harsh environmental conditions. Addressing these issues promptly is critical to avoid extended downtime during snow events.

Further conversations regarding the boss snow plow wiring harness involve diagnostic techniques and repair strategies. Forum discussions often feature advice on using a multimeter to test for continuity and voltage, as well as recommendations for cleaning corroded connections and repairing damaged wires. Maintaining Your Boss Snow Plow Wiring Harness

Proper maintenance of the boss snow plow wiring harness is essential for ensuring reliable operation and extending its lifespan. Regular inspections, proactive cleaning, and proper storage during the off-season are key elements of a comprehensive maintenance plan. These simple steps can prevent many common problems and minimize the risk of unexpected failures during critical snow removal operations. A well-maintained harness translates directly into increased efficiency and reduced downtime.

Visual Inspection

Regularly inspect the wiring harness for signs of damage, such as frayed wires, cracked insulation, or corroded connectors. Pay close attention to areas where the harness is exposed to abrasion or stress. Early detection of damage allows for timely repairs and prevents further deterioration. A thorough visual inspection should be conducted before each snow season and periodically throughout the winter. Neglecting this simple step can lead to more significant problems down the road.

Connector Cleaning

Clean the connectors with a specialized electrical contact cleaner to remove dirt, grime, and corrosion. Ensure the connectors are completely dry before reconnecting them. Using dielectric grease on the connectors can help prevent future corrosion and maintain a good electrical connection. This preventative measure is particularly important in regions where salt is heavily used on roadways. Proper connector cleaning can significantly improve the reliability of the harness and prevent intermittent failures.

Wire Protection

Protect exposed wires with protective conduit or electrical tape to prevent abrasion and damage from the elements. Ensure the harness is properly secured to prevent it from rubbing against sharp edges or moving parts. Using cable ties and clamps can help keep the harness in place and prevent unnecessary wear and tear. Proper wire protection is crucial for maintaining the integrity of the harness and preventing short circuits.

Off-Season Storage

When the snow season is over, disconnect the wiring harness and store it in a dry, protected environment. This prevents corrosion and damage from moisture and extreme temperatures. Wrapping the harness in a plastic bag can further protect it from dust and debris. Proper off-season storage can significantly extend the life of the harness and ensure it is ready for use when the next snow season arrives.

What type of grease should be applied to the connection points in a boss snow plow wiring harness?

Dielectric grease, also known as silicone grease, is the recommended type of lubricant for electrical connectors in a boss snow plow wiring harness. It is a non-conductive compound that helps seal out moisture and prevent corrosion, which are common causes of electrical failures in harsh environments. This grease also helps to facilitate a better electrical connection by filling in microscopic air gaps between the connector surfaces. Applying dielectric grease during installation and maintenance can significantly prolong the life and reliability of the wiring connections.

Regularly Inspect Connections

Inspect all connections for corrosion, looseness, or damage. Clean corroded connections with a wire brush and apply dielectric grease to prevent future corrosion. Tighten any loose connections and replace damaged connectors as needed. Regular inspection and maintenance of connections are crucial for ensuring a reliable electrical connection.

Protect Wires from Abrasion

Protect exposed wires with wire loom or electrical tape to prevent abrasion from rubbing against sharp edges. Ensure the wiring harness is properly secured to prevent it from shifting or becoming entangled. Abrasion can damage the insulation of the wires, leading to short circuits and electrical failures.

Use Dielectric Grease

Apply dielectric grease to all electrical connections to prevent corrosion and improve conductivity. Dielectric grease is a non-conductive lubricant that helps seal out moisture and contaminants. Reapply dielectric grease whenever connections are disconnected or cleaned.

Secure the Harness Properly

Secure the wiring harness with cable ties or clips to prevent it from hanging loosely or dragging on the ground. A loose wiring harness is more susceptible to damage from abrasion and impact. Proper securing of the harness ensures it remains protected and out of harm’s way.

Disconnect During Off-Season

Disconnect the wiring harness during the off-season to prevent corrosion and damage from environmental elements. Store the harness in a dry, protected location away from direct sunlight and extreme temperatures. Off-season storage helps prolong the lifespan of the harness and ensures it is ready for use when needed.

Test the System Regularly

Test the entire snow plow system regularly to ensure all functions are working properly. Check the lights, plow movement, and any other electrical components. Early detection of any issues allows for timely repairs and prevents minor problems from escalating into major failures.
